How they compare

MDG: Sub-saharan Africa currently reports 435,437 against 4,493 in Congo, a difference of 430,944.

That makes MDG: Sub-saharan Africa's figure about 96.9 times Congo's.

Across all 24 years both countries report, MDG: Sub-saharan Africa has been ahead every year.

Congo ranks 120th and MDG: Sub-saharan Africa ranks 118th of 185 countries.

MDG: Sub-saharan Africa has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Congo MDG: Sub-saharan Africa Difference Ahead
1980s 521 58,216 57,695 MDG: Sub-saharan Africa
1990s 982.8 97,221 96,238 MDG: Sub-saharan Africa
2000s 880 181,562 180,682 MDG: Sub-saharan Africa
2010s 3,444 338,248 334,804 MDG: Sub-saharan Africa

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
